Maintenance The price and convenience of coffee espresso machines can be attractive for a lot of businesses, but the quality and taste of their beverages depend on the level of care they receive. Establishing a routine cleaning schedule for these small appliances will ensure that they continue to offer high-quality drinks and shots for a long time. Every day maintenance begins with emptying the drip tray which is where you can collect the milk and espresso residue after every use. This can be done up to once a day, based on the machine and how you use it. It is also important to clean the portafilter, grouphead and water screen regularly. These parts are prone for grime buildup that can lead to poor extraction and rancid flavors. Every week, you should clean the steam tip, portafilter, and group head using a soft nylon toothbrush. Also, clean the buttons and head gasket using a non-abrasive cleaning agent. Business owners should soak their items like the drip tray and gratings for the night in accordance with the manufacturer's instructions. Certain manufacturers recommend descaling their products on a regular basis, however the frequency of descaling can differ based on the water's hardness and how frequently you use your machine. When descaling, you should begin by filling the reservoir with a solution for descalingaccording to the instructions of the product regarding the amount of water to add.
